英文摘要 | We conjecture that all CP violations (both Dirac and Majorana types) arise from a common origin in the neutrino seesaw. With this conceptually attractive and simple conjecture, we deduce that mu-tau breaking shares the common origin with all CP violations. We study the common origin of mu-tau and CP breaking in the Dirac mass matrix of seesaw Lagrangian (with right-handed neutrinos being mu-tau blind), which uniquely leads to inverted mass ordering of light neutrinos. We then predict a very different correlation between the two small mu-tau breaking observables theta(13) - 0 degrees and theta(23) - 45 degrees, which can saturate the present experimental upper limit on theta(13). This will be tested against our previous normal mass-ordering scheme by the ongoing oscillation experiments. We also analyze the correlations of theta(13) with Jarlskog invariant and neutrinoless beta beta-decay observable. From the common origin of CP and mu-tau breaking in the neutrino seesaw, we establish a direct link between the low energy CP violations and the cosmological CP violation for baryon asymmetry. With these we further predict a lower bound on theta(13), supporting the ongoing probes of theta(13) at Daya Bay, Double Chooz, and RENO experiments. Finally, we analyze the general model-independent Z(2) circle times Z(2) symmetry structure of the light neutrino sector, and map it into the seesaw sector, where one of the Z(2)'s corresponds to the mu-tau symmetry Z(2)(mu tau) and another the hidden symmetry Z(2)(s) (revealed in our previous work) which dictates the solar mixing angle theta(12). We derive the physical consequences of this Z(2)(s) and its possible partial violation in the presence of mu-tau breaking (with or without the neutrino seesaw), regarding the theta(12) determination and the correlation between mu-tau breaking observables. |
